What are the electrical considerations when installing a hot tub in an outdoor structure?

When it comes to installing a hot tub in an outdoor structure such as a garden or patio, there are several important electrical considerations to keep in mind for the safety and functionality of your hot tub. Ensuring that the electrical setup meets the necessary requirements and is properly installed is crucial to avoid any potential hazards or performance issues. This article will outline the key electrical considerations to take into account when installing a hot tub in an outdoor structure.

1. Electrical Capacity

The first and most important consideration is to determine if your existing electrical system has the capacity to handle the additional load of a hot tub. Hot tubs require a significant amount of electricity to operate, so it is essential to consult with a qualified electrician to assess the electrical capacity of your outdoor structure and make any necessary upgrades or modifications to accommodate the hot tub.

2. Grounding and Bonding

Proper grounding and bonding are critical for the safety of hot tub installations. Grounding ensures that any fault in the electrical system is directed to the ground, preventing electric shock. Bonding, on the other hand, bonds all metal components of the hot tub, including its control panel, pumps, and heater, creating a low-resistance path for electrical current. Both grounding and bonding measures should be installed in accordance with local electrical codes and regulations.

3. GFCI Protection

Ground Fault Circuit Interrupter (GFCI) protection is a must-have for hot tub installations. GFCI devices detect any imbalance in electrical current and quickly disconnect the power supply to prevent electric shock. A GFCI breaker or outlet should be installed in line with the hot tub's electrical supply to ensure the highest level of safety.

4. Weatherproof and Watertight Connections

Since the hot tub will be located in an outdoor structure exposed to the elements, it is crucial to use weatherproof and watertight electrical connections. This ensures that water, moisture, or debris cannot penetrate the electrical components, safeguarding against electrical shorts and damage. Waterproof conduit, wiring, and connectors specifically designed for outdoor use should be used to ensure the durability and longevity of the electrical setup.

5. Dedicated Circuitry

Hot tubs typically require their own dedicated circuitry to handle the significant electrical load they demand. This means that no other appliances or devices should be powered by the same circuit as the hot tub. A dedicated circuit ensures that the hot tub has sufficient power without causing tripped circuits or overloaded electrical systems.

6. Location Considerations

The location of the hot tub within the outdoor structure should also be carefully considered from an electrical standpoint. It should be placed in a spot where there is easy access to the electrical panel and where the electrical cables can be hidden or protected. Additionally, the location should allow for proper drainage and ventilation to avoid any potential water damage or moisture-related issues.

7. Professional Installation

Lastly, it is highly recommended to have a professional electrician handle the installation of the hot tub's electrical system. A qualified electrician will ensure that all the necessary electrical considerations are met, including proper wiring, grounding, bonding, and adherence to local electrical codes. Professional installation not only guarantees safety but also helps maintain the warranty of the hot tub.
